FYI:
You should read the actual terms of the BMW Military Incentive. Being a PenFed member does not qualify a person without them being able to provide proof through I’d.me that the buyer is military. Yes, the dealer may screw up and give it to you, so you will win. However, when the dealer gets audited by BMW in the future, those who the dealer can’t prove were military will result in BMW forcefully taking those incentive $’s back from the dealer. Not from you, but the dealer. Just be informed, particularly if you care at all about personal integrity. |

That is the way all dealerships will operate. If you didn't meet the eligibility, in this case being a PenFed member for 60 days, then you wouldn't be able to get the certificate. Other than making sure the name on the certificate is correct they don't need to do any other verification.

My dealer's accounting team just processed it. It took them a bit to figure out but they eventually got there. They should be able to put the code through their system and get it - it's no skin off their back - they get reimbursed by BMW so they should not have a financial reason to want to reject it. It's more likely the extra effort to figure it out is causing them to say "no." I would just be adamant - say you called BMW NA and PenFed and they said it's fine… you know others they got it etc. direct them that it's a type J etc. |
